CLEMENTS ALLOCATION A 26-35

CLEMENTS ALLOCATION A 26-35 is a Texas oil lease in Borden County, Railroad Commission district 08, operated by Murchison Oil And Gas, LLC.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 2023 to August 2026, totalling 106,295 barrels.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$2.5M, with roughly $805K exp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 1,420 barrels a month. Its strongest month on the record we hold was April 2023, at 7,339 barrels.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 17%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

How much is CLEMENTS ALLOCATION A 26-35 worth?
The remaining production from CLEMENTS ALLOCATION A 26-35 is estimated to be worth about $2.5M in total as of 27 August 2026, within a range of $2.1M to $3.0M.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in CLEMENTS ALLOCATION A 26-35 is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production CLEMENTS ALLOCATION A 26-35 has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year.
